(GSBC) reported first-quarter 2026 earnings per share (EPS) of $1.58, significantly exceeding the consensus estimate of $1.3158 by 20.08%. Revenue figures were not disclosed in the available data, and the stock experienced a slight decline of 0.32% in the following trading session. The robust EPS surprise highlights the company’s operational efficiency and resilient core business, though the muted market reaction suggests investors may be weighing broader macroeconomic uncertainties.

Great Southern Bancorp’s EPS of $1.58 marks a notable outperformance relative to analyst expectations, driven largely by solid net interest income and disciplined expense management. As a regional community bank, its performance likely benefited from a stable net interest margin and growth in its core deposit base, which provides a low-cost funding advantage. While specific segment breakdowns were not provided, the earnings beat may reflect strong loan portfolio yields and controlled credit costs. The company has historically focused on a relationship-driven banking model, and such factors may have supported revenue generation during the quarter. Additionally, non-interest income streams, including service charges and fee-based services, may have contributed to the better-than-expected bottom line. However, without explicit revenue figures, the full picture of top-line trends remains unclear. The stock’s mild decline of 0.32% could indicate that the EPS beat was already priced in or that market participants are concentrating on future headwinds such as potential margin compression or loan demand volatility. Overall, the quarter suggests that Great Southern continues to execute well within its local markets.
